The Acorn Archimedes is 25 years old this month. The first machines based on the company's ARM (Acorn Risc Machine) processor were announced in June 1987, the year after the 32-bit chip itself was launched.     4. Andrew Garrard

      Re: 1 colour?

      Actually the high res mode (which needed a special monitor) was 1152x896, using one bit per pixel. Sometimes it's worth using Wikipedia for fact checking. All the Arabella-based systems could do 1, 2, 4 or 8 bits per pixel. There was also a bash at resolution independence - coordinates were downsampled according to the mode, so in 1152x896 one coordinate step mapped to one pixel, but in mode 12 (640x256, 16-bit) pixels were two coordinates apart horizontally and four coordinates apart vertically (the next pixel above and to the right of 0,0 was 2,4). Mode 13 (320x256, 256 colour) was downsampled by 2 in each direction.

      You *could* do 640x512 in 256 colours (mode 21) with a MultiSync monitor, but before the ARM3 turned up with a cache, it didn't leave much bandwidth for the CPU to do anything. Later systems like the A5000 with faster RAM added mode 31 (800x600, 256 colours) etc. And the VIDC20 in the RiscPC added 16- and 32-bit modes and a more programmable video clock.

  3. Jason Togneri
    Stop

    Some factual errors

    There are even more rabid fanboys than I in the RISC OS world, so I'll preempt them (or maybe just warm them up) with a few points:

    "Risc", as you point out, is an acronym. Thus it should be RISC. Ditto "RiscOS", which should also be two words: RISC OS. "Rom" should be ROM. Confusingly, the last Acorn machine was the RiscPC (in lower case), but the official logotype has a sort of half-space, so most people write is all joined up as I do. Finally, the mouse buttons on an Acorn machine were referred to as Select, Menu and... Adjust, not "Alter".

    There seems to be some confusion about the difference between Lander and Zarch: the former was a demo of the latter. The demo (Lander) shipped with most machines in this era, while the game (Zarch) was a commercial full product. It was exactly the same game on the PC, but known as Virus. The player's ship in that was not triangular (it was non-symmetrically pentagonal), and is the same shape as the Copperhead ship from Bell and Braben's game Elite.

    Two final points. First: "Archimedes morphed into the Risc PC line, a series of ARM-based boxes designed to run Windows – on a co-processor, and presented in a Risc OS window." No. Just no. The RISC PC was never *designed* to run Windows - it was designed to run RISC OS natively, and use hardware-based emulation to run Windows within RISC OS. The "co-processor" wasn't a true one in the sense you seem to be inferring; the primary CPU was an ARM610, 710 or some variant of the StrongARM processor, while the secondary CPU was a specially designed 4x86 or 5x86 card which could *only* be used by the emulated copy of Windows. It was also not a default item included with the RiscPC, but usually a seperate purchase.

    Finally, there's the fact that you say the line stopped with the death of Acorn/Element 14, without mentioning anything about the two spin-off companies RISC OS Ltd or Castle Ltd. Acorn's demise left RISC OS at 4.02, and ROL/CTL developed this further in two confusingly-numbered parallel brances, known as RISC OS 5 and RISC OS 6 (also known under the names RISC OS Select and RISC OS Adjust). There were also the the Iyonix, the Omega, and some other hardware designed and sold in the post-Acorn era. And last but not least, there are ongoing efforts to port RISC OS to small boards like the BeagleBoard and the Raspberry Pi, these mostly happening through RISC OS Open Ltd (ROOL), a spin-off created when Castle decided to open parts of the RISC OS source.

  6. druck Silver badge
    Thumb Up

    Fantastic machines

    Fantastic machines massively ahead of their time. The 8MHz ARM 2 (not 4MHz as in the article) was about 25x faster than the BBC B, 15x faster than an original PC and 6x faster than a PC AT on Byte benchmarks. It came with built in better than VGA colour graphics, and 4 channel sound, no need for graphics and sound cards before it could do even the most basic things. They could also take 4 (not 2) podule expansion cards including one providing all the digital and analogue I/O we enjoyed on the Beeb.

      1. Steve Knox
        Boffin

        Re: Seriously thought about gettig an A440

        You'd only need a 32-bit CPU to natively address 640MB (actually what you'd need is a CPU with an address bus at least 30 bits wide.)

        The 80286 did come with an on-chip MMU , which allowed for logical addressing up to 1GB in protected mode, but sadly it was limited to 16MB of physical RAM (24-bit address bus). You could use additional hardware to provide bank switching (a la Expanded Memory), but I don't personally know of this being used to access up to 640MB of RAM.
